当前位置:首页 > 问问

cpu集成了运算器和什么 CPU内置了什么部件?

1、内部缓存

随着CPU不断提升速度,在执行指令时需要访问内存的时间也成为了瓶颈之一。为了加速指令的执行效率,CPU集成了内部缓存。内部缓存位于CPU内部,相对于外部内存较为接近,因此可以大大提高CPU访问内存的速度。

内部缓存分为L1、L2、L3缓存,其中L1缓存最小但是速度最快,L3缓存最大但是速度最慢。CPU可以根据访问次数和访问速度的不同将数据缓存到相应的缓存级别中,使得CPU执行指令时可以更快地获取到需要的数据,大大提升了CPU的工作效率。

2、浮点运算单元

除了运算器以外,CPU还集成了浮点运算单元。在执行高精度计算、图形处理等需要大量浮点运算的任务时,浮点运算单元可以实现更快速的浮点运算,提高了任务的执行效率。

浮点运算单元一般包括加法器、减法器、乘法器、除法器等功能模块,可以实现各种复杂的浮点运算操作。随着CPU的发展,浮点运算单元的性能不断提高,可以支持更高精度、更快速的运算操作。

3、指令缓存

除了内部缓存以外,CPU还集成了指令缓存。指令缓存主要存储指令的二进制码,当CPU需要执行某个指令时,会从指令缓存中读取相应的二进制码。由于指令缓存比内部缓存更加专注于指令的存储,因此可以更好地提高指令的获取速度。

指令缓存一般采用静态随机存取存储器(SRAM)来实现,在CPU内部与其他模块相连,可以直接传输指令数据,从而大大提高了指令的执行速度。

4、高速总线

作为计算机系统中不可或缺的组成部分,CPU需要通过各种总线与内存、硬盘、外设等其他组件进行交互。为了满足高速数据传输的需求,CPU集成了高速总线。高速总线也被称为前端总线或者系统总线,是计算机系统中数据传输的重要通道。

高速总线的速度越快,CPU与其他组件之间的数据交互就能够更加快速和稳定。随着CPU性能的不断提高,高速总线的带宽也在不断提升,使得计算机系统能够实现更加高效的数据处理和传输。

声明:此文信息来源于网络,登载此文只为提供信息参考,并不用于任何商业目的。如有侵权,请及时联系我们:fendou3451@163.com
标签:

  • 关注微信

相关文章